SK hynix beats Samsung in quarterly profit for first time
South Korean chipmaker SK hynix has reported higher quarterly operating profit than its competitor, Samsung Electronics, for the first time.
In the October-December 2024, SK hynix reported an operating profit of 8.08 trillion won (US$5.62 billion), a 15% increase from last year.
In contrast, Samsung expects a fourth-quarter operating profit of 6.5 trillion won (US$4.5 billion).
SK hynix’s strong performance was driven by rising demand for AI memory chips, particularly high bandwidth memory (HBM) chips, despite declining demand for conventional memory chips.
Samsung, the largest global memory chipmaker , has been slower to introduce its HBM products, which may impact its ability to benefit from the AI-driven demand.
